SMA compatible extended-K connector,
Mode-free performance at the resonance point
Eliminate the possibility of inaccurate data measurements
Anritsu announced on the 2nd that it is launching the 'Extended-K™ connector family' that supports mode-free performance and traceable performance up to 43.5 GHz.

Anritsu explains that the Extended-K connector family “offers price and performance advantages along with proven electrical characteristics, high reliability, and harsh environment ruggedness for high-frequency applications such as 5G backhaul, aerospace and defense transceiver systems, and millimeter wave (mmWave) body scanners.”
When designing and configuring systems that do not require high-frequency ranges above 43.5 GHz, users can test with the Extended-K connector, which is compatible with the SMA connector commonly used in lower-frequency ranges, without the need for a 2.4 mm to SMA gender.
All Extended-K connectors are manufactured to Korea Research Institute of Standards and Technology (KRISS) standards, and their mode-free performance up to 43.5 GHz eliminates the possibility of inaccurate data measurements at resonance points. Furthermore, they provide 99% parameter accuracy across the specified frequency band. It is certified to MIL-PRF-39012 and MIL-STD-202F, ensuring reliability and durability even in harsh environments.
The Extended-K connector, which operates in the DC~43.5GHz range, eliminates the need to use a 2.92mm to 2.4mm gender adapter on an expensive 2.4mm connector if operation above 43.5GHz is not guaranteed.
Anritsu's new connector family can be used in a wide range of applications, from component connectors to PCBs and test equipment.
